Virginia House is an appealing and dog-friendly holiday home situated in the picturesque village of Scorton, near Richmond in North Yorkshire. Accommodating up to eight guests, this unique property serves as an ideal retreat for families and friends seeking a serene escape amidst breathtaking countryside. The house boasts original features and overlooks the oldest raised village green in the UK, providing a delightful and historical backdrop for a memorable stay.
The interior of Virginia House is spacious and thoughtfully designed, featuring a cozy living room with traditional wooden beams and a flat-screen Smart TV, complemented by comfortable leather seating. The modern white kitchen, equipped with essential appliances such as an oven, hob, and dishwasher, contrasts beautifully with wooden worktops, making it perfect for self-catering. Guests can also enjoy the secure garden, complete with an outdoor dining area and barbecue, enhancing the outdoor experience.
With four well-appointed bedrooms, Virginia House ensures a restful stay for all guests. The tranquil first bedroom features plush carpets and a super king-size bed, while the second bedroom offers an ensuite king-size option. The third bedroom includes a double bed, and the fourth bedroom can be configured into two singles upon request, making it versatile for different group arrangements. The family bathroom is bright and airy, featuring both a bath and a separate shower for added convenience.
Located in the heart of Scorton, guests have easy access to scenic walks in the Yorkshire Dales and nearby attractions such as Ellerton Lakes and Kiplin Hall. Dining options are available at The Farmers’ Arms, conveniently located next door. Richmond, just a short drive away, offers a wealth of historical sites, including the oldest theatre in Europe and the impressive Richmond Castle. With ample opportunities for walking, dining, and cultural experiences, Virginia House provides a perfect base for exploring the rich offerings of North Yorkshire.
